I was looking through my old CDRs and I came across one with a bunch of Indian rock tunes I downloaded in 2003-04- mostly rubbish but some good stuff by Zebediah Plush,Little Babooshka's Grind,Cryptic,Nightmare on Elm Street,Friday the 13th,Them Clones,Cyanide Angels and Blackstratblues.

The one I REALLY enjoyed playing again and again was a spectacular all guns blazing version of Bach's Brandenburg Concerto No.3 Movement 3 by a band called Nirvikalpa - the bassoon and cello parts are replaced by screaming guitars and the rest of the strings by piano.

ITs MUCH MUCH better than the Walter/Wendy Carlos version!
